Decision
The Executive agreed the
recommendation as outlined above namely:
1.
To note the report.
2.
To require the respective directors, Chief Executive
and Director of Resources to continue to closely monitor and manage
service financial and operational performances, specifically Growth
and Prosperity, Children’s Services, Place, Strategic Leisure
Assets, Adult Services and the wholly-owned companies.
3.
To note the Scrutiny Leadership Board will continue
to independently review the financial and operational performances
of Council services.
4.
To continue to lobby central government (Ministry of
Housing, Communities and Local Government, Department for Health
and Social Care and Department for Education in particular) along
with local authority peers and networks and the Local Government
Association for the funding necessary to cope with the burdens and
demands presenting as a result of inflationary pressures and
demographic demands upon statutory services.
5.
To continue to work towards target working balances
of £7m by 1 April 2026.
